AVAX One Technology announced its preliminary revenue forecast for early 2025, expecting revenue of $2.3 million and an EBITDA loss of $7.3 million. Nearly half of the revenue is expected to come from the fourth quarter, thanks to the launch of its digital asset Avalanche. The company projects revenue for 2026 to be between $11 million and $44 million, with EBITDA ranging from $2 million to $25 million, depending on cryptocurrency price trends. CEO Jolie Kahn stated that the company's transition to AVAX, including staking and accumulation services, is expected to expand revenue and improve profitability, while the company will continue to execute a $40 million share repurchase plan.
